Longhorn sounding like Cairo

Related linksToday's breaking news
Send to a friendFeedback


Network World Fusion 08/31/04

David Card of Jupiter Research wins the award for best reaction to Microsoft's announcement that it is scaling back Longhorn:

bwahahahahahahahahah

He was referring specifically to a quote from Bill Gates that Microsoft is doing better on developing Longhorn than IBM did on OS/360 - which, you might recall, IBM built in the 1960s. Card adds he's increasingly reminded of Cairo, the last Microsoft OS that was going to change the way we live.
